IMPMP303 Carry out pre-slaughter inspection activities (red meat)
Overview
This standard is about the skills and knowledge needed for you to carry out pre-slaughter inspection activities in red meat. Carrying out pre-slaughter inspection activities is important to the maintenance of red meat species welfare and the production of a final product that meets organisational and regulatory requirements.
This standard applies specifically to work activities in relation to the provision of assistance to the Official Veterinarian. You will need to be able to:
Be properly equipped and attired to carry out the inspections
Carry out inspections of the carcass and offals of each designated red meat species
Follow the procedures for detention, partial rejection and total rejection of carcasses and offal
Make a range of judgements with regard to specific conditions and carry out any further designated action relevant red meat species involved
Record and report reasons for rejections
This standard is for you if you work in food operations and are involved in carrying out pre-slaughter inspection activities (red meat).
Performance criteria
You must be able to:
wear and use personal protective equipment required when carrying out pre-slaughter inspection activities according to regulatory standards and organisational requirements
check availability and cleanliness of equipment and work area
access regulatory and organisational specifications and standard operating procedures
recognise normal and abnormal red meat species and take appropriate action according to organisational requirements
carry out inspections of uneviscerated red meat species according to regulatory and organisational requirements
carry out inspections of carcasses, cavity inspections and viscera and other specified by-products according to organisational and regulatory requirements
check that the carcasses of red meat and offal unfit for human consumption are rejected and removed appropriately from the edible processing operation
collect and initiate communication of inspection results to the relevant people
make judgements on the fitness or unfitness for human consumption of the carcasses and offal of the red meat presented for inspection
work within the limits of your responsibility, reporting problems to the relevant people when necessary
Knowledge and understanding
You need to know and understand
the correct personal protective equipment and the equipment and facilities to carry out the appropriate inspections
the required form of presentation for carcasses and offal for inspection
the method of inspection as required by the relevant regulation/s
what is abnormal red meat and its significance
the basic principles of red meat species diseases including zoonotic and notifiable diseases
the procedures for detention, partial rejection and total rejection of carcasses and offal
the importance of, the purpose of and the method of reporting and recording the reasons for rejections of carcass meat and offal
the importance of working within the limits of your responsibility and reporting problems to the relevant people
